How to Change the Oil in a 2016 Yamaha RAPTOR 700 R
Maintaining your 2016 Yamaha Raptor 700 R is crucial for optimal performance and longevity. One of the most important maintenance tasks is changing the oil. Regular oil changes ensure that your engine runs smoothly and efficiently. Follow this guide to change the oil in your Raptor 700 R.

Tools and Materials Needed
- Oil filter wrench
- Socket wrench set
- Drain pan
- Funnel
- New oil filter
- 4-stroke engine oil (Yamaha recommends Yamalube 10W-40)
- Clean rags
Steps to Change the Oil
- Warm Up the Engine: Start the engine and let it run for a few minutes. This helps the oil drain out smoothly by thinning it.
- Turn Off the Engine: Ensure the engine is off and the ATV is on a level surface.
- Remove the Skid Plate: Use a socket wrench to remove the bolts holding the skid plate in place. Set the skid plate aside.
- Drain the Oil: Place the drain pan under the engine. Use the socket wrench to remove the drain bolt and let the oil drain completely. Be cautious as the oil may be hot.
- Replace the Oil Filter: Use the oil filter wrench to remove the old oil filter. Apply a small amount of new oil to the gasket of the new oil filter and install it by hand. Tighten it securely.
- Reinstall the Drain Bolt: Once the oil has completely drained, reinstall the drain bolt and tighten it securely.
- Add New Oil: Using a funnel, pour the new oil into the engine. The 2016 Yamaha Raptor 700 R typically requires about 2.5 quarts of oil. Check the oil level with the dipstick and add more if necessary.
- Reattach the Skid Plate: Secure the skid plate back in place using the bolts you removed earlier.
- Check for Leaks: Start the engine and let it run for a few minutes. Check for any oil leaks around the filter and drain bolt.
Important Notes for the 2016 Yamaha Raptor 700 R
The 2016 Yamaha Raptor 700 R is known for its powerful engine and excellent handling. Regular maintenance, including oil changes, is essential to keep it performing at its best. Always use the recommended oil type & filter to ensure compatibility and performance. Additionally, check the oil level regularly and top up as needed to prevent engine damage.
